Attractive location for motorists
The facility is located in the Kuyavian-Pomeranian Voivodeship, in the Golub-Dobrzyń County. This region is rich in history, with castles (Golub-Dobrzyń), fortified settlements, and picturesque landscapes. For tourists traveling by car, Lampka is an excellent base for exploring Toruń, Chełmno, or Brodnica, offering a peaceful place to unwind after a day full of excitement.
